Output d81656b8a94149c29c685dbb2e061d6127b862e76504c0944fd13e4e8f144ac3:1

value
46114560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d3d09609b31969f6fd78dc06ae13e5f0868a556 OP_EQUAL
address
M97A8piCPPo3w7xLPdyqZkQ1FD7HqCDY2z
transaction
d81656b8a94149c29c685dbb2e061d6127b862e76504c0944fd13e4e8f144ac3
spent
true